WebAverage Pregnancy Weight Gain Chart. 7 1/2 pounds is about how much the baby will weigh by the end of pregnancy. 1 1/2 pounds is how much the placenta weighs. 4 pounds is attributed to increased fluid volume. 2 … WebMay 25, 2024 · Recommended weight gain during each trimester for women with normal BMI before conception is. First trimester: Weight gain should be minimal. Most women gain 2 to 4 pounds during the first trimester. Some women may lose some weight due to morning sickness, which is normal. WebNot gaining enough weight can cause your baby to be born too small, too early or with birth defects. Gaining too much weight can lead to problems during your pregnancy like high blood pressure, swelling and gestational diabetes. It may cause your baby to be born too big or too early, or increase your chance of requiring a Cesarean section.
